>Java >java지도 시간 >Java 소프트웨어 개발의 경력 전망 및 개발 잠재력을 평가합니다.

Java 소프트웨어 개발의 경력 전망 및 개발 잠재력을 평가합니다.

WBOY
WBOY원래의
2024-01-24 09:50:16739검색

Java 소프트웨어 개발의 경력 전망 및 개발 잠재력을 평가합니다.

Java 소프트웨어 개발 분야의 경력 전망과 개발 기회를 살펴보세요

Java는 강력한 기능과 광범위한 애플리케이션 시나리오를 갖춘 소프트웨어 개발 분야에서 널리 사용되는 프로그래밍 언어입니다. 현대 소프트웨어 개발 산업에서 Java 개발자는 광범위한 경력 전망과 풍부한 개발 기회를 가지고 있습니다. 이 기사에서는 Java 소프트웨어 개발의 경력 전망과 그에 따른 개발 기회를 살펴보고 특정 코드 예제를 사용하여 실제 개발에서 Java를 적용하는 방법을 보여줍니다.

최근 정보기술의 급속한 발전과 인터넷의 대중화로 인해 소프트웨어 개발 산업은 호황을 누리고 있습니다. 널리 사용되는 크로스 플랫폼 프로그래밍 언어인 Java는 소프트웨어 개발 분야에서 중요한 역할을 합니다. 대기업이든 신생 기업이든 거의 모든 Java 개발자에 대한 수요가 있으므로 Java 개발자의 취업 전망은 매우 넓습니다.

우선, Java는 다양한 응용 분야에서 널리 사용되는 프로그래밍 언어입니다. 웹 애플리케이션, 모바일 애플리케이션, 데스크탑 애플리케이션 등 Java는 중요한 역할을 할 수 있습니다. 예를 들어 Java 프레임워크인 Spring과 Spring Boot는 웹 애플리케이션 개발에 널리 사용되며 Android 개발도 Java 언어를 기반으로 합니다. 이 밖에도 자바는 빅데이터 처리, 인공지능 등 분야에서도 널리 활용되고 있다. Java 개발자는 다양한 기업의 요구 사항을 충족하기 위해 전문 분야를 선택할 수 있습니다.

둘째, Java 개발자는 직업 안정성이 강합니다. 엔터프라이즈 애플리케이션 개발에서 Java의 중요한 위치로 인해 Java 개발자에 대한 수요는 항상 높았습니다. 많은 대기업과 금융 기관이 Java를 사용하여 복잡한 시스템을 구축하므로 Java 개발자가 지속적으로 필요합니다. 이러한 회사에는 소프트웨어 시스템을 유지 관리하고 개선하기 위해 Java 개발자가 필요하므로 Java 개발자는 종종 안정적인 직업과 더 높은 급여를 찾을 수 있습니다.

또한 Java 개발자를 위한 개발 기회도 매우 풍부합니다. 소프트웨어 개발 기술이 계속 발전함에 따라 Java 생태계도 성장하고 있습니다. 많은 새로운 프레임워크와 도구가 등장하여 Java 개발자에게 더 많은 학습 및 개발 기회를 제공합니다. 예를 들어, Spring Boot는 최근 몇 년 동안 매우 인기 있는 Java 개발 프레임워크로, 기존 Java 개발 프로세스를 단순화하고 개발 효율성을 향상시킵니다. Kotlin은 Android 개발에서 Java와 호환되는 프로그래밍 언어로, Java 개발자에게 더 많은 선택권을 제공합니다. 또한 Java 개발자는 클라우드 컴퓨팅, 빅데이터 처리 및 기타 분야의 관련 기술을 학습하여 경쟁력을 향상시킬 수도 있습니다.

다음은 구체적인 코드 예시를 통해 실제 개발에 Java를 적용하는 모습을 보여드리겠습니다.

예제 1: 간단한 Java 웹 애플리케이션

import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
import java.io.IOException;

public class HelloServlet extends HttpServlet {
    public void doGet(HttpServletRequest request, HttpServletResponse response) throws IOException {
        response.getWriter().println("Hello, World!");
    }
}

예제 2: 간단한 Java 데스크톱 애플리케이션

import javax.swing.*;

public class HelloWorld {
    public static void main(String[] args) {
        JFrame frame = new JFrame("Hello World");
        JLabel label = new JLabel("Hello, World!");
        frame.add(label);
        frame.setSize(300, 200);
        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
        frame.setVisible(true);
    }
}

위의 코드 예제는 웹 애플리케이션 및 데스크톱 애플리케이션 개발에 Java를 적용하는 방법을 보여줍니다. Java 개발자는 Java의 다양한 기술과 프레임워크를 학습하고 마스터함으로써 다양한 분야에서 만족스러운 경력 개발을 찾을 수 있습니다.

간단히 말하면 Java 소프트웨어 개발에는 폭넓은 경력 전망과 풍부한 개발 기회가 있습니다. 정보 기술의 지속적인 개발과 혁신으로 인해 소프트웨어 개발 분야에서 Java의 위치는 점점 더 중요해지고 있습니다. Java 개발자는 지속적으로 학습하고 기술을 향상함으로써 빠르게 성장하는 이 산업에서 안정적인 일자리와 수익성 있는 수입을 찾을 수 있습니다. 소프트웨어 개발 산업에 입문하려는 초보자이거나 이미 Java 개발에 종사하고 있는 사람이라면 Java 기술을 마스터하는 것이 현명한 선택입니다.

위 내용은 Java 소프트웨어 개발의 경력 전망 및 개발 잠재력을 평가합니다.의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.